In this episode, Nick Jameson shares his journey from aerospace engineering and defence to data leadership. He discusses why the fail fast mindset is important for Data Innovation, how high-stakes environments influence building resilient data platforms, the importance of problem-solving, stakeholder engagement and managing technical debt. Gain insights into effective leadership, balancing innovation with foundational stability and the future of data engineering and analytics.
